1. Technological Evolution: From Forward‑View to Side‑View & From 30fps to 60fps

SF-YL0320-V1SF-N1050-V1 led 10

For decades, most medical and industrial endoscopes used forward‑view optics with fiber or CMOS sensors. Frame rates were typically 30fps, adequate for slow inspection but causing motion blur during dynamic procedures (e.g., vocal cord examination, moving pipeline robots). Meanwhile, side‑view was achieved via prisms or mechanical rotation, adding complexity and cost.

The advent of high‑speed CMOS sensors (like the OV2740) with native 60fps output and miniaturized side‑view lens assemblies has changed the landscape. Now, a mini Camera Module with side‑view optics and 1080P@60fps can be integrated into devices as small as 5–6mm in diameter. The combination of UVC Camera Module driver‑free connectivity further lowers adoption barriers for OEMs.

 

2. Key Market Drivers

a. Minimally Invasive Medical Procedures

ENT, laryngology, and oral surgery require real‑time, high‑frame‑rate lateral views of moving tissues (e.g., vocal folds, tongue base). 60fps eliminates judder, and side‑view allows direct inspection of laryngeal ventricle or subglottic region without probe bending. The 1080P Camera Module delivers the resolution needed for accurate diagnosis.

 

b. Beauty & Personal Care Devices
Blackhead removers, skin analyzers, and oral cameras have become consumer favorites. Users expect clear macro views of skin pores, blackheads, or tooth surfaces from a lateral angle. A 2MP Camera Module with side‑view optics and integrated LED illumination provides the necessary detail and ease of use. The small form factor of mini Camera Module fits into handheld beauty wands.

 

c. Industrial Confined‑Space Side Inspection
Pipe inner walls, engine cylinders, and mold cavities often require inspection of vertical or horizontal surfaces that are inaccessible to forward‑view probes. A side-view endoscope camera module allows non‑dismantling assessment of weld seams, corrosion, or cracks. Low distortion (<2%) ensures accurate measurement.

4. Future Outlook

Higher frame rates (120fps) will emerge for extremely fast motion capture, though bandwidth and processing power will be constraints.

AI‑assisted image enhancement (real‑time denoising, edge detection) may be integrated into the module or a small companion processor.

Wireless side‑view endoscopes using WiFi 6 or 5G will become more common for telesurgery and remote inspection.

Modular front‑ends allow swapping between different viewing angles (0°, 90°, 120°) on a common USB back-end.
